Gunshow

Dim Sum-Style Ingenuity

Atlanta-native Kevin Gillespie, who you may recognize as the lovable bearded chef who killed it on Top Chef season 6, opened his flagship restaurant Gunshow in May 2013. At this sparsely decorated Glenwood Park eatery, diners don’t order off a menu, but rather from chefs who roll their dishes through the dining room on carts, tempting guests with innovative and diverse selections. Inspired by Brazilian churrascaria-style dining and Chinese dim sum, this inventive approach makes for a lively, interactive dinner experience where chatting with the folks who prepared your food is encouraged. They’re showcasing the best of Georgia’s ingredients with dishes like nicoise salad made with local rabbit, traditional Mexican-style braised goat from Decimal Place Farm, and a Low Country boil with catfish, Pine Street andouille and Georgia shrimp. In one night you may see a Uruguayan-style mixed grill with chimichurri alongside a pistachio and white truffle baklava served with roasted foie gras. For a restaurant with such a large scope of cooking styles and flavors, it’s impressive that they manage to pull it off perfectly.
